NBC News will feature taped segments during the 9 a.m. and 10 a.m. hours of “Today,” according to a person familiar with the matter, while co-anchors Al Roker and Craig Melvin remain at home, the latest change to some of TV’s best-known news programming in the wake of the spread of the coronavirus around the nation.
Savannah Guthrie and Hoda Kotb will continue to anchor the morning franchise’s flagship 7 a.m. to 9 a.m. broadcast, this person said, and then provide a live news update at 9 a.m.
